Understanding Provably Fair Gaming: A Foundation for Player Trust

Traditional online casino games often operate on opaque algorithms, leading to concerns about potential manipulation or bias. Provably fair technology, rooted in blockchain principles, revolutionises this paradigm by generating outcomes that can be independently verified by players. This system hinges on cryptographic hashing and transparent data exchange, empowering players to confirm that neither the house nor any malicious third party could alter results post hoc.

For instance, in a classic digital dice game, the server provides a seed hash before the game begins, which the client can verify after the game concludes. These cryptographic assurances bolster confidence among users, fostering a premium experience that blends entertainment with accountability.
